Recently we've received a lot of questions and interest around training routes for Music Therapy careers, and we love to see it! Here's what you need to know about training to be a Music Therapist.

In order to practice as a Music Therapist in the UK, you must complete a MA training course validated by the Health and Care Professions' Council (HCPC) and obtain state registration with the HCPC.

There are currently ten training courses in the UK. These Masters Level courses are offered both full time and part time, depending on the institution. You can find the full list of HCPC-approved training courses and find out more about them on our website: https://www.bamt.org/training.

New podcast!🎙️In the latest episode of Music Therapy Conversations, Crystal Luk-Worrall interviews Mary-Clare Fearn, a HCPC registered Music Therapist, neurologic Music Therapist, supervisor, trainer and consultant with many years of experience working with children, young people and adults across education, healthcare and community settings.

Listen here or wherever you get your podcasts: https://www.bamt.org/DB/podcasts-2/mary-clare-fearn

Mary-Clare is recognised for her integrative and collaborative approach, combining relational, trauma-informed and neurologic frameworks to optimise therapeutic outcomes for clients and the wider systems supporting them. She is currently working with children with SEMH needs, autism, and learning disabilities, as well as providing Music Therapy on a paediatric hospital ward.
